    St Magnus Road phone box was a regular haunt for my mum and I in the early 1960`s. Mum used to save up the change for the phone all week, then use the box to phone her sister at work the day her boss was out at womens guild meeting.

    Almost positive it is my late mum in the box and I am sitting patiently on the wall waiting for her with (probably Adele Gold or Margaret Green) and Lawrence Money (in the wellie boots) and William Lush (walking towards the phone box)

    My OH recognised mum right away and dad is pretty certain he recognised my pigtails and baldy bit.

    We got the phone at home about 1965 hence the early 1960`s timeline.
